Wastewater sludge production is continuously increasing world-wide due to urbanisation and population growth. To solve this problem, incineration is the most preferred solution in many developed countries. Beside its relatively high costs, the main drawback of this method is that the valuable compounds found in the sludge are incinerated and lost. Another widely used solution in large scale is the digestion of sewage sludge for biogas production. These digesters are often not economically sustainable in case of small and medium sized waste water treatment plants. Thus, for most of our clients, small and medium sized wastewater treatment plants (WWTP) in Europe, the treatment of sewage sludge represents one of the biggest problems.
The overall objective of the reNEW project is to commercialize products recovered from sewage sludge through our innovative technology. In our process, the sewage sludge is biologically transformed into a liquid phase which contains volatile fatty acids (VFA) and valuable micro and macro nutrients (NPK), which are recovered. These products represent important market value: VFA as raw material for eco-labelled cleaning agents, and NPK as fertilizer.
